Transaction 602e8d9463fd91400f8fc9a3673e0634df27a6886ec19fcde4f63dc776e3899c
1 Input
1 Output
-
602e8d9463fd91400f8fc9a3673e0634df27a6886ec19fcde4f63dc776e3899c:0
- value
- 2564843
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d963ab7fcd522e7e1153ab921178af1b2fa16cb
- address
- bc1qrktr4dlu653w0cg482ujz9u27xe059kthu3p00